It's getting harder to focus every day

I’m feeling it right now. I had to set a timer for 15 minute on my computer and block all distractions to write this. If I didn’t force myself to focus I would easily get distracted by something after few minutes. Even when I’m doing things that I’ve been waiting to do it, I still feel the urge to do something else. I don’t know how and when this happened. During the last few years I was always studying, working, and doing open source. And actually got stuff done. Doing all of those at the same time requires paying attention to what I wanted to do and ignore the noise.
